IFRC Framework for Evaluation

The purpose of this IFRC Framework for Evaluation is to guidehow evaluations are planned, managed, conducted, and utilized by the Secretariat of the International Federation of Red Cross and Red Crescent Societies. The framework is designed to promote reliable, useful, ethical evaluations that contribute to organizational learning, accountability, and our mission to best serve those in need.
